Abstract

Security and confidentiality of data and information is the most important aspect of human activity undertaken. One way to maintain the security and confidentiality of personal data and the group is through cryptography and steganography techniques are believed to provide protection to the data and information held on the parties concerned. Through the incorporation of cryptography and steganography is expected to improve security on the data and information. This research was conducted by combining methods MMB on cryptography and steganography method of LSB in that run on Windows-based operating systems and can only hide a message with .txt format bitmap image format. MMB method is the development of IDEA method that uses 128 bit keys along the subblok divided into four pieces, each of which has a length of 32 bits. LSB method is a method that inserts the last bit of each pixel with a bit of the message.
